Organise what you know
Research & knowledge tools
Keep all your documents in one place and ask plain-English questions of them — answers grounded in your own material, not the open internet.
NotebookLM
Research notebookUpload your docs, then ask questions answered only from those sources — and even get an audio overview.
Turn a folder of reports or policies into something you can interrogate.

Connect your tools
MCPs — plug AI into your software
MCP (Model Context Protocol) is the standard that lets your assistant securely connect to the apps you already use — including your accounts software — so it can read, draft and act, not just chat.
MCP basics
The standardWe demystify what an MCP is and connect Claude to a real app, live, in the session.
Understand the “plug” that turns a chatbot into a working assistant.
